
An airplane established by Boom Supersonic came to be the very first independently funded jet to break the sound barrier today. The XB-1 aircraft sped up to Mach 1.05 at concerning 35,000 feet throughout an examination trip Tuesday in the exact same Mojave Desert airspace in The golden state where Charles “Chuck” Yeager was the very first individual to damage the in 1947.

It was an action towards revitalizing supersonic business traveling, which has actually gotten on respite given that the Concorde jet was based greater than 20 years earlier.
Boom Supersonic has agreements with at the very least 2 airline companies to purchase their business airplanes once they are established. A number of firms are functioning ahead up with brand-new supersonic jets that would certainly be much more gas reliable– and develop less climate-changing exhausts– than the Concorde.
Boom’s creator and chief executive officer Blake Scholl states the trip “shows that the modern technology for traveler supersonic trip has actually shown up.”
The examination airplane was made with light-weight carbon fiber and utilizes an increased fact vision system to aid with touchdown as a result of its lengthy nose.
Boom, based in Denver, intends to utilize the modern technology to build its Overture commercial airliner, which the business states can bring as numerous as 80 travelers while taking a trip faster than the rate of audio. The jets would certainly be integrated in North Carolina.
The business has claimed the engine it’s creating for the Advance will certainly have 35,000 extra pounds of drive and is developed to work on lasting aeronautics gas.
American Airlines and United Airlines havepledged to buy jets from Boom Supersonic Boom claimed in 2015 it has orders for 130 airplane, that include orders and pre-orders.
Those business trips can be restricted to sea crossings or would certainly need to reduce over land to restrict damages from powerful sonic booms, which can rattle structures ashore.
NASA is taking a look at creating a craft with a softer boom, and Boeing is likewise servicing a model for supersonic business traveling.
Any type of brand-new such solution will likely encounter the exact same difficulties as the Concorde, which flew over the Atlantic and was disallowed from numerous overland paths due to the sonic booms it triggered.
The Concorde jet, which was based in 2003, was the only supersonic business airplane that ever before flew, and had its initial trip in 1969.
At the time it was taken into consideration a technical wonder and a resource of satisfaction in Britain and France, whose aerospace firms signed up with pressures to generate the aircraft.
The aircraft holds the document for the fastest transatlantic going across by a traveler airplane– 2 hours, 52 mins and 59 secs from London’s Heathrow Flight terminal to New york city’s Kennedy Flight terminal.
Yet the Concorde never ever went mainstream, as a result of difficult business economics and its sonic booms that led it to be prohibited on numerous overland paths. Just 20 were constructed, 14 of which were made use of for traveler solution.
A dangerous collision greater than 20 years ago accelerated the jet’s death. On July 25, 2000, an Air France Concorde collapsed right into a resort and blew up soon after departure in Paris, eliminating all 109 individuals aboard and 4 on the ground. Detectives established that the aircraft ran over a steel strip, harming a tire that collapsed right into the bottom of the wing, bursting a gas storage tank.
